NSA: Voting for Sportsman and Sportswoman Closed, Voting Phase of Nigerian Sports Award Ends.

The Voting phase for the third edition of the Nigerians Sports Award is closed. The public voting which began on September 18, 2014 for the Sportsman of the year and the Sportswoman of the year award closed on Sunday November 2, 2014.
Nominated for the sportsman of the year award are Super Eagles Goalkeeper, Vincent Enyeama, Ogenyi Onazi and Osaze Odemwingie while Blessing Okagbare is nominated alongside Asisat Oshoala and Courtney Dike for the sportswoman of the year award.
According to the General Manager, Unmissable Incentive Limited, Organizers of the award said that the public’s vote will amount to 60 per cent while the panel will reserve 40 per cent of the votes that will determine the eventual winners of the awards.
Kayode Idowu stated that only the Sportsman and Sportswoman of the year categories are open for votes by members for the public while other categories will be determined by the award panel based on achievement of the athletes during the course of the year of the award.
According to Idowu, many of the expected sports personalities both within and outside the country have already confirmed their attendance for the November 13 event.
The third edition of the Nigerian Sports Award will hold on Thursday November 13, 2014 at the Muson centre, Onikan Lagos.
The award event is expected to be covered and broadcast live for the 2 hour duration by Supersports and other local TV stations.
